Up for sale is my 1971 Dodge Dart Swinger. This is a low mileage (approximately 35,000), NEVER rusty survivor with one repaint. It was originally a 318/904/7.25 car. I bought it 100% stock. This is now a very fast street/strip car with an original style appearance. The weatherstripping is good, the doors don't sag, windows go up and down, etc. Paint is nice, shiny, not cracked. Not Barrett Jackson, but a LOT better than Maaco. Reserve price is lower than the cost of the parts!

The engine is a 5.9 Magnum disguised to look like an LA 360, 904 with transbrake, A body 8.75 rear end, Cal tracs and monoleafs, calvert shocks. It has been converted to the larger bolt pattern wheels (5*4.5) and front disk brakes from Stainless Steel Brakes. It has new fuel lines, new brake lines, new gas tank, new exhaust, new vinyl top and on and on and on. All the best stuff. 

This car has run a best time of 11.70 @ 113 on an 8" slick. Don't let that fool you though, this is not a pure race car, and it is a blast to drive on the street (it has mufflers and is not ridiculously loud). It is almost zero maintenance (hydraulic roller cam -not solid). It gets lots of attention at that shows and the track.

If racing is your thing, there is a ton of performance left in this car. It is tuned for street-strip and it is full wieght with the entire original interior.

Camaro driver clocked at 171 miles per hour

Wed, Apr 13 2016

Chevy's 2016 Camaro SS is a fantastic piece of automotive engineering. It is also, apparently, very, very fast. This latter fact was perfectly illustrated when, on April 8, a Camaro SS driver was nailed in Two Harbors, Minnesota for doing 171 mph. According to WFAA, the unnamed speed demon was flying down Highway 61 near Two Harbors when Hermantown, MN Deputy Police Chief Shawn Padden clocked him at an eye-watering 171 mph. He then recorded the speeder at 168 and 141. At the time, Deputy Chief Padden was working with Minnesota State Patrol on an anti-DWI program called "Toward Zero Deaths". Padden, who was interviewed by the Duluth News Tribune, said he was surprised at the driver's sheer speed. "When he went by me, it was a blur," Padden told the News. "You get used to seeing people going 65 or 70 and what that looks like. But I've never seen anything like this. It's like a rocket on wheels." Fadden chased the Camaro down eventually, but it took some doing. To catch the Camaro, he pushed his Dodge Charger Pursuit to 135 mph just to get into range so the Camaro could see his emergency lights. The speeding driver was ticketed for careless driving, but may lose his license due to a Minnesota law that gives courts the option of revoking licenses for drivers caught doing more than 100 mph. Chop the top of your new Dodge Viper for $35,000

Mon, 21 Jul 2014

We have good news, and we have bad news. First, the good: It's now possible to get a brand-new Dodge Viper roadster, which is nice, considering we're in the dead of summer and many of us like wind-in-the-hair motoring. Now, the bad: This is not a factory option from the automaker, instead coming courtesy of an aftermarket company called Prefix Performance, and that means it's going to cost you some serious coin.
Called Medusa, this drop-top Viper was created without the knowledge or consent of Dodge, but that's probably fine because Prefix works with the automaker already for the final preparation of the American supercar, including paint. According to the company, the current, fifth-gen Viper was built with a convertible version in mind, so no chassis strengthening is required. From the looks of the somewhat grainy photos available, the conversion appears of very high quality.
Want one? Well, that means you're going to need to procure a Viper - Prefix has 10 units ready for transformation as it stands - and that's going to cost at the very least $102,485. Then, you'll need to write a check for an additional $35,000 for Prefix to surgically remove the car's roof. Thing is, for that kind of cash, a prospective owner could buy, among other very nice options, a Viper hardtop and a loaded Miata, or a Corvette Stingray convertible and several pockets full of change. Or, perhaps a new Viper hardtop and a used, first-gen Viper convertible?
